Crossix is a health-focused technology company dedicated to advancing healthcare marketing with analytics and innovative planning, targeting, measurement, and optimization solutions. Positioned at the center of big data, innovative technology, and multichannel media, Crossix, a Veeva Company, provides our clients with insights to help make strategic business decisions and drive improved patient outcomes. The Role

We are currently seeking an IT Engineer to join our team in New York, NY. The IT Engineer must be resourceful, technical, able to think quickly, and love to work in a fast-paced environment. For the right candidate, this is a fun job with a dynamic and growing company where you will be given the opportunity to contribute and learn. You must have a sense of autonomy, job ownership, drive tasks to completion, attention to detail, and be willing to take on new challenges.

What You'll Do

  • Manage and deploy corporate PC’s/Mac’s (new hardware configuration, image maintenance, diagnosis and repair, coordinate warranty repairs).
  • IT-related tasks including onboarding of new hires, diagnose and repair of end-user IT devices, desk moves, IT ticket management, and remote support.
  • Inventory and maintain IT asset data (serial numbers, software keys, locations, etc.).
  • Support of all IT systems and tools (VPN, Okta, Zoom, Office365, G Suite, JIRA/Confluence, etc.)

Requirements

  • Minimum 3 years in a Level II, Level III support or similar role
  • Experience with Microsoft Windows, macOS, and Linux
  • PC/Mac hardware repair and troubleshooting
  • Ability to install, upgrade, troubleshoot, and maintain all types of software
  • Excellent verbal and interpersonal skills
  • Extreme customer focus
  • Experience documenting processes and training end-users
  • Highly motivated individual with experience getting things done in a fast-paced environment

Nice to Have

  • Experience with Cisco Meraki
  • Experience with G Suite and Office 365
  • Networking knowledge and experience
  • Knowledge of Asset Management best practices
  • Four-year degree in Computer Science/Information Technology or equivalent experience.
